Thus, … Web11.2 Multiplication tables For small sets, we may record a binary operation using a table, called the multiplication table (whether or not the binary operation is multiplication). Web16 dec. 2024 · To determine whether an element has a multiplicative inverse, we must check if it can be multiplied with another element to produce 1: Elements without a multiplicative inverse in Z 4 are 2 and 0 Elements without a multiplicative inverse in Z 6 are 2, 3, 4 and 0
